Purefoy Arms pub up for sale for £60,000

The Purefoy Arms pub in Hampshire has been put on the market with a guide price of £60,000 by Christie & Co, Winchester.

 

The Grade II-listed property features a 20-cover bar, a 40-cover restaurant, four bedroom owners' accommodation, a rear garden and a car park.

 

It also has two semi-detached storage barns, one of which is a fully fitted-out bakery.

 

A Rightmove listing for the pub states there is scope to develop the site further through a conversion of the side barns, subject to planning permission.

 

Chef Gordon Stott opened the Purefoy Arms in May 2018, following his role as head chef of the Sun Inn in Hampshire.

 

The listing states the pub reported a net turnover of £617,284 and earnings before interest, tax, depreciation and amortisation (EBITDA) of £60,962 for the year ending 30 September 2022.
